These are images straight out of the camera. I wanted to show what you can expect from using the camera in a typical outing. In this case a trip to a carnival in town. Not an ideal condition for any camera. It was dark so flash was used on every shot. I was not paying much attention to focus control--just pointing and shooting. I was happy with the results.
